∠1 ​ and ∠2 are supplementary. ∠1=3x°∠2=(2x−25)° What is the value of x? Select from the drop down menu to correctly answer the

question. X = Choose.

Answer:

x=41

Step-by-step explanation:

supplementary angles add to 180

3x + (2x-25) = 180

5x = 205

x= 41

 angle1          3x41 = 123

angle 2 (2x41) -25 = 57

 123 +57 = 180
